Action item from the Driftmoor incident review: archive all cold storage buckets older than 18 months in the Halverson data tier. During the outage, stale buckets inflated the recovery scan from minutes to hours because the restore job walked every object. Owner is the Tidewell platform team; target is end of next quarter. Archival must use the Coldhatch lifecycle policy, not manual moves, so retention metadata stays intact. The bucket inventory, eligibility criteria, and sign-off checklist are maintained on the internal tracking page.

wiki page, fahaf-yagag: https://confluence.qorvellabs.internal/pages/display/pages/display

Ticket #4821 — Expired credentials blocking pagination tests on Lanternview API

The public REST API for Lanternview exposes cursor-based pagination on /v2/listings, and our nightly contract tests walk all pages to verify cursor stability. Those tests began failing after the service credential expired last Friday. No data exposure occurred; requests were rejected at the gateway with 401s. Security review is requested before we provision the replacement. The newly issued key for the internal pagination-test harness follows below.

gateway credential: kto7_GoY89Me

Runbook — Chirpwell deploy-status bot. If the bot stops answering in the release channel, check the Lanternly webhook queue first; a backlog over 500 means the poller is wedged. Restart the poller, not the bot. Confirm recovery by asking it for current deploy state; its reply should echo the token below.

pipeline stamp: htk6_0e97e6

## Break-glass access — Wavescroll preview renderer

The Wavescroll service draws waveform previews for all uploads at Fernhollow Audio. If both primary admins are unreachable and the renderer must be restarted or reconfigured urgently, break-glass access applies. Use it only for genuine outages, and file an incident note within one hour. The emergency console will prompt for the maintainer recovery passphrase, which is recorded here for continuity:

strongbox words: gilok-druion-briath-wendor-briion-prawyn-fenion-oliir-casdor-holius-briius-gilath-gilael-pelys